NIGHT SPAWN

On one night after an autumn full moon, elkhorn corals across much of the Caribbean simultaneously release sperm-and-egg bundles that mingle and then break apart as sperm finds eggs from different parents. Coral fertilization may decline as increasing carbon dioxide pushes seawater closer to acidity. Credit: Evan D”Alessandro/RSMAS, University of Miami
